What quality paid 0–100 lb

Frame and muscle grade
Frame / muscleAvg wt$/cwt$/headHead
Medium and Large 1379166.8963229
Medium and Large 2373154.7057714thin
One grade step is worth $12.19/cwt here — about $55 a head. Across this sale the premium is widest at 0–100 lb. USDA reports each grade on its own line and never publishes the spread.
